USBFunctionDriverSubkey \idProduct Product identifier to be defined by the manufacturer. The default buffer size is 0x1000. Required fields are marked * Comment:* Name:* Email:* Website: − 5 = 0 Recently Published Easy steps to developing an application using DM3730 Win32 Vs .NetCF Vs Silverlight Windows Embedded bcdDevice:dword USB function client device's release number, in binary-coded decimal (BCD) format. http://dwp2001.com/drivers-usb/drivers-usb-optical-storage-device.php
USB Function Client Driver Registry Settings (Compact 2013) 3/26/2014 The registry settings for each USB function client driver are in the %_WINCEROOT%\Public\Common\OAK\Files\Common.reg file. You can read the explanation in MSDN. And also is the memory debug shows the physcial or virtual address? When I try I don't receive it. https://msdn.microsoft.com/en-us/library/ms895481.aspx
But i have no idea why "DeactivateDevice" fails. Can a DLL map an alias to a statically mapped region in OemAddrMapTable ? Copy [HKEY_LOCAL_MACHINE\Drivers\USB\FunctionDrivers] "DefaultClientDriver"=- ; erase previous default [HKEY_LOCAL_MACHINE\Drivers\USB\FunctionDrivers] "DefaultClientDriver"="RNDIS" [HKEY_LOCAL_MACHINE\Drivers\USB\FunctionDrivers\RNDIS] "UseActiveSyncIds"=dword:1 [HKEY_LOCAL_MACHINE\Drivers\USB\FunctionDrivers\RNDIS] "Dll"="rndisfn.dll" "FriendlyName"="Rndis" "idVendor"=dword:045E "Manufacturer"="Generic Manufacturer (PROTOTYPE--Remember to change idVendor)" "idProduct"=dword:0301 "Product"="Generic RNDIS (PROTOTYPE--Remember to change idVendor)" "bcdDevice"=dword:0 See Also
The following table describes the USB function client driver registry settings common to all USB function client drivers. USBFunctionDriverSubkey\DeviceNameIdentifies the name of the store to expose to the USB host. The following registry keys show the default USB function serial client driver registry settings. Our target has flash starting at 0, SRAM starting a 0x40000000, and SDRAM starting at 0x10000000.
However, if the system owner decides to dynamically change the USB Function client drivers on the device, due to a hardware limitation like the number of USB end points, then the Is it also possible that I show the contents of FFSDISK? If this value is not in the registry or is set to 0, the standard communication class values are used. http://developer.toradex.com/knowledge-base/usb-function-driver-(colibri) Registry keyDescription UseActiveSyncIdsIf this value is set to anything besides zero (0), RNDIS sets the Device Class, Device Subclass, and Device Protocol codes in the USB device descriptor and interface descriptor
http://msdn.microsoft.com/en-us/library/aa909606.aspx Geoff Can in-line assembler instructions IN, OUT, STI and CLI be used on Windows XP Em use Windows XP embedded as our platform (which is more reliable to our Kiosk To use the USB Function Composite device driver the appropriate registry keys are set as explained below. To modify these settings for your hardware platform, add the registry keys you need to alter to your hardware platform's Platform.reg file. Yes No Additional feedback? 1500 characters remaining Submit Skip this Thank you!
MaxPacketSize:dword Maximum packet size for endpoint zero. https://www.e-consystems.com/blog/windowsce/?p=465 The FlashDisk will disappear from the module root folder because it's now dedicated to the USB mass storage function. [HKEY_LOCAL_MACHINE\Drivers\USB\FunctionDrivers\Mass_Storage_Class] DeviceName="DSK0:" ; DSK0: is the internal FlashDisk. (DSK1: is the default Paul T.Thanks for your answer, The device s plugged into the bus, what interrupts are available, where the hardware will be mapped in the memory map, etc. Developer Network Developer Network Developer Sign in Subscriber portal Get tools Downloads Visual Studio SDKs Trial software Free downloads Office resources SharePoint Server 2013 resources SQL Server 2014 Express resources Windows
There are three possibilities in the Toradex default image: Serial Class (Default) Mass Storage Class RNDIS To change this, you have to set one of the following registry values: [HKEY_LOCAL_MACHINE\Drivers\USB\FunctionDrivers] DefaultClientDriver="Serial_Class" I get the following error: Warning Debugger service map is set to none. USBFunctionDriverSubkey \DeviceName Identifies the name of the store to expose to the USB host. Registry key Description UseActiveSyncIds If this value is set to anything besides zero (0), RNDIS sets the Device Class, Device Subclass, and Device Protocol codes in the USB device descriptor and
The following registry keys show the default USB function serial client driver registry settings. I also tested your suggestion (DeactivateDevice -> ActivateDevice) but with the same result. Prblm in OS download Hi: I am facing problem in downloading the OS (nk.bin) ? weblink Registry keyDescription DeviceArrayIndexUse to load different USB function serial client driver objects.
About GPS and Map software Hello everyone, is there any Map software for windows CE 5.0, talk to GPS throught uart interface? Priority256Determines the priority of incoming packets for RX thread processing. Through this system it is possible to accomplish the dynamic loading and unloading of individual USB Function client drivers.
Replace appropriately. For Pocket PC and Smartphone, this value is set by default. It doesn't matter what storage is it as far as it is addressable/readable from DOS (supported by BIOS or you have a corresponding DOS driver for it). I try running the RemoteAdmin wizard from the CE device and I seem to be able to set the various configurations except when it comes to the Local Area CE device?
Thanks in Advance.I think this could help you a little bit: http://blogs.msdn.com/hopperx/archive/2005/06/29/433842.aspx Alexander Stack Overflow Questions Developer Jobs Documentation beta Tags Users current community help chat Stack Overflow Meta Stack Overflow Also specify the platform.reg contents.Thanks for ur comment. Loading Single Interface Descriptor Device on Composite Driver Classes like Mass storage and USB serial are containing single interface descriptors. USBFunctionDriverSubkey is a placeholder string that represents a client driver.
The build tools (romimage.exe) create the structure there, and then put a pointer to it in pTOC. F&S Elektronik Systeme GmbH As this is an international forum, please try to post in English. USBFunctionDriverSubkey \Dll DLL name for the USB function client driver. Each string is a two digit hexadecimal value.
I tried to enter this command line and it gives me the usage statement. Do you debug vai Ethernet:-)? You can retrieve suitable names by checking under HKEY_LOCAL_MACHINE\System\StorageManager\Profiles. Under previous version of the operating system, before the addition of the USB Function Composite device driver, switching to a different client could be accomplished by changing the protocol used by
Visit http://www.usb.org to obtain a vendor identifier. device?ThanQ Braden, But can I access pnpId from my user program(application) ?. It is possible to generate a Ram Drive (Ramdisk) to expose as the mass storage. for ActiveSync DefaultClientDriver="Mass_Storage_Class" ; Module behaves like USB mass storage device DefaultClientDriver="RNDIS" ; Module behaves like a USB network adapter Select storage location for Mass Storage Class Windows CE 6.0 When
What was the abort address? Now there is a situation that a device having a mass storage functional driver, custom HID functional driver and a UVC functional driver (Composite device) will be loaded simultaneously on a The default client (if specified) will get the notification if the USB Function Composite device driver was unable to determine the correct recipient for the notification.
I figured if I could read from the port directly I would loose the overhead of ReadFile and my timing problems would be resolved. On Windows CE, the same sort of operation happens in the header _Unicode, the code will reference SetWindowTextA(), but the libraries won't resolve that and the system DLLs don't have it. Each string is a two digit hexadecimal value (client driver configuration index) or "X". I read something about DeviceIoControl and IOCTL_UFN_CHANGE_CURRENT_CLIENT but when I try to use this, the board reboots automatically...